Ryder is a big, friendly, and slightly cheeky goof of a hound whose heart is as big as his whippy waggy tail. Ryder could join a medium or large sized doggie ‘sibling’ that complimented his social and playful nature. Ryder has been assessed as unable to go to a home with cats. The little humans in his home would preferably be nine years old or older as his enthusiasm when playing could be a little much for tiny tots. Talking about playing, Ryder LOVES toys and is often seen throwing them to himself as he bounces around. he hopes his future home has a big toy box for him. Ryder has no problem staying home alone for more than six hours at a time as long as he has a comfy dog bed to snooze in and some chewy treats to pass the time. A daily routine of one or two 20 minute walks and play sessions will keep his tail wagging and his goofy heart full.

If you’re looking for a joyful companion who is equal parts snuggle and silliness, Ryder is ready to be a part of your life.

Our Adoption Process

Submit Your Application

The information your provide when submitting an application helps the team find your best match. This information can include other four and two legged members of the home, the length time the dog will be left alone and your desired temperament.

Match Making & Info Gathering

The GAP Team will review your application and may get in contact with any additional questions. From this information they will check through our available greyhounds to find your perfect match.

Meet Your Match

Check your emails for your perfect match's profile. If you agree with our team we'll be in contact to arrange "Meet & Greet" appointment at our Southern River Facility. All going well, the chosen doggo will head home with you that day. Had a different dog in mind? No worries, we'll find another pooch for your home.

Welcome Home!

As a part of the Meet & Greet the team will talk you through how to settle your new friend into your home. There will also be information sent via email ahead of the appointment and printed to take home. The GAP team are available to provide support during these exciting times.
